Synopsys full_case parallel_case
http://yang.zone/podongii_X2/html/technote/TOOL/MANUAL/21i_doc/data/fndtn/ver/ver7_3.htm WebJan 1, 1998 · At Boston SNUG 1999, I introduced the evil twins of Verilog synthesis, "full_case" and "parallel_case.(2)" In the 1999 Boston SNUG paper I pointed out that the full_case and parallel_case ...
Synopsys full_case parallel_case
Did you know?
Webfull-case and parallel-case // synopsys parallel_case tells compiler that ordering of cases is not important that is, cases do not overlap e. g. state machine - can’t be in multiple states … WebIf only one case item is executed, the logic generated from a parallel_case directive performs the same function as the circuit when it is simulated. If two case items are …
WebJuly 17, 2024 at 10:09 AM. casez synthesis wrong results. Hi All, Is casez statements allowed in Vivado synthesis ? i am getting wrong results (ORed of a_i and b_i) for casez FPGA synthesis for below RTL code. In RTL simulation the priority is recognized correctly and getting expected results. But in FPGA netlist the results are wrong. Webcase (A) \\ synopsys full_case parallel_case 3’b100 : Y = 2’b11; 3’b010 : Y = {1’b0,F}; 3’b001 : Y = {F,1’b0}; default : Y = 2’b00; endcase Select one: a. A and C b. No two produce the …
WebSynopsys is an American electronic design automation (EDA) company headquartered in Mountain View, California that focuses on silicon design and verification, silicon … WebNov 17, 2005 · synopsys map_to_module synopsys Verilog Directives are: translate_off translate_on map_to_module return_port_name full_case parallel_case async_set_reset sync_set_reset async_set_reset_local sync_set_reset_local async_set_reset_local_all sync_set_reset_local_all one_hot one_cold It seems there is no keep_signal_name …
http://referencedesigner.com/tutorials/verilog/verilog_21.php
WebOct 17, 2012 · To the synthesis tool, full_case and parallel_case are command-directives that instruct the synthesis tools to potentially take certain actions or perform certain optimizations that are unknown... organic cleavershttp://yang.zone/podongii_X2/html/technote/TOOL/MANUAL/21i_doc/data/fndtn/ver/ver7_3.htm how to use cricut maker for beginnersWebOct 29, 2004 · synopsys full case parallel case hi, According to RMM second version and some paper from snug, dont use full_parallel , it may cause simulation difference between … how to use cricut maker machineWebAugust 11, 2014 at 12:26 PM. FULL_CASE PARALLEL_CASE synthesis directive. Hi, Can somebody explain why use of full_case and parallel_case is discouraged. i understand that use of parallel_case can lead to bad designs, if used when case statement conditions are not mutually exclusive (parallel) . but could'nt find any reason to not use full_case ... organic clicksWeb//synopsys full_case or //synopsys parallel_case directives. The same applies to any //ambit synthesis, //cadence or //pragma directives of the same form. When these synthesis directives are discovered, Verilator will either formally prove the directive to be true, or, failing that, will insert the appropriate code to detect failing cases at ... how to use cricut maker penWebLeveraging the latest formal technologies and Machine Learning techniques, Synopsys VC Formal™ has the capacity, speed and flexibility to exhaustively verify some of the most complex SoC designs, find deep corner-case design bugs, and achieve formal signoff. Natively integrated with Synopsys VCS®, Verdi®, VC SpyGlass™, VC Z01X Fault ... how to use cricut maker without matWebDec 16, 2024 · Verilog code using Synopsys full_case directive. Full size image. While using this directive, care should be taken; the reason being the presynthesis and post-synthesis results may not be matched. ... 3.2.3 Synopsys parallel_case Directive. Most of the time we observe the overlapping case conditions which can result into the priority logic ... organic clementine tree